Durability and Weather Resistance

Calgary experiences extreme temperature fluctuations, from freezing winters to warm summers. Stainless steel gutter guards are known for their superior strength and corrosion resistance, making them a durable option for long-term use. They can withstand heavy snow, ice buildup, and the freeze-thaw cycle without warping or degrading.

Aluminum gutter guards, while also resistant to rust, are generally lighter and may not be as strong as stainless steel. Over time, they can bend or dent under heavy snow loads, which is a common occurrence in Calgary’s winters. However, aluminum is still a good option for moderate conditions and provides excellent protection against leaves and debris.

Effectiveness in Gutter Protection

Both stainless steel and aluminum gutter guards help prevent clogs caused by leaves, twigs, and debris. However, stainless steel mesh designs tend to offer finer filtration, preventing even small particles from entering the gutters. This can reduce the need for frequent gutter cleaning and help maintain proper water flow.

Aluminum guards are available in various designs, including perforated sheets and mesh. While they offer good protection, some models may allow smaller debris to pass through, requiring occasional maintenance to keep gutters clear.

Cost Considerations

The initial cost of stainless steel gutter guards is usually higher than aluminum due to their enhanced durability and performance. However, their long lifespan and minimal maintenance requirements can make them a cost-effective investment for homeowners who want to avoid frequent gutter cleaning in Calgary.

Aluminum gutter guards are generally more affordable upfront, making them an attractive choice for budget-conscious homeowners. However, they may require replacement sooner if exposed to heavy snow and ice.
